Mayo 3 idineklarang regular holiday para sa Ramadan

By Chona Yu May 02, 2022 - 01:34 PM

Idineklara ng Palasyo ng Malakanyang na regular holiday ang Mayo 3, 2022.

Ito ay para sa paggunita sa Eid’l Fitr o Feast of Ramadan ng mga Muslim.

Nilagdaan ni Pangulong Rodrigo Duterte ang Proclamation No. 1356 noong araw ng Linggo, Mayo 1 pero sa araw ng Lunes lamang, Mayo 2, ini-release sa publiko.

“The entire Filipino nation should have the full opportunity to join their Muslim brothers and sisters in peace and harmony in observance and celebration of Eid’l Fitr, subject to the public health measures of the national government,” saad ng proklamasyon.

Una rito, inirekomenda ng National Commission on Muslim Filipinos na ideklarang holiday ang Mayo 3.

Gayunman, nagsimula ang selebrasyon ng mga Muslim sa araw ng Lunes matapos ianunsyo ng Grand Mufti of the Bangsamoro Darul-Ifta na namataan na ang buwan.
